About this album
Where they were
Released on May 7, 2021, 'Latest Record Project: Volume 1' arrives as Van Morrison's first major release since his 2019 album 'Three Chords and the Truth'. At this point in his career, Morrison is a seasoned artist, continuing to explore themes of personal reflection and social commentary, exemplifying his enduring relevance in contemporary music.
Why it matters
'Latest Record Project: Volume 1' sparked controversy due to its politically charged lyrics, particularly regarding COVID-19 restrictions, leading to significant media attention. The album reached number one on the UK Albums Chart, showcasing Morrison's ability to resonate with audiences while stirring public debate.
Essential tracks
- "Thank God for the Blues" — This track reflects Morrison's deep-rooted appreciation for blues music, serving as both homage and personal narrative that encapsulates the album's themes.
- "Stop Bitching, Do Something" — With its direct lyrical content addressing societal issues, this song stands out as a bold call to action amidst the album's more introspective moments.
- "Where Have All the Rebels Gone?" — This track questions cultural complacency and rebellion, encapsulating Morrison's reflective yet critical stance on modern society.
